About Dangping Luo
Dangping Luo is a scholar working on Plant Science, Molecular Biology, Biotechnology, Infectious Diseases and Organic Chemistry, having authored 9 papers that have together received 1.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Plant Molecular Biology Research (3 papers), Plant Pathogenic Bacteria Studies (3 papers), Plant-Microbe Interactions and Immunity (2 papers), Photosynthetic Processes and Mechanisms (2 papers), Plant nutrient uptake and metabolism (2 papers), Plant responses to water stress (2 papers), Plant tissue culture and regeneration (2 papers) and Legume Nitrogen Fixing Symbiosis (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Plant Science (1.1k citations), Molecular Biology (580 citations), Horticulture (7 citations), Genetics (178 citations) and Agronomy and Crop Science (49 citations). Dangping Luo has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Bing Yang, Wolf B. Frommer, Joon‐Seob Eom, Jungil Yang, Chonghui Ji, Masaharu Suzuki, Jeffrey Ross‐Ibarra, Davide Sosso, Joëlle Sasse and Karen E. Koch. Their work appears in journals such as Nature Genetics, New Phytologist, Plant Communications, Nature Biotechnology and The Plant Cell.
